Other Team Members: |
Dual physician coverage for each patient is standard including an internist to manage the patient's medical condition and a physiatrist to oversee the patient's rehabilitation prescription.
Staff Skin and Wound Specialist Nurse available for consultation regarding wound prevention and management.
Staff Cardiac Nurse Clinician works with Interdisciplinary Cardiopulmonary Rehabilitation Team to provide telemetry interpretation and patient monitoring, education and support.
